As February draws to a close, Samsung is poised to conclude the rollout of its February 2025 security update for its Galaxy series. In the meantime, the company is expanding the update for Galaxy Z Fold 3 and Flip 3 devices to additional countries, just days after its initial release in South Korea.
The February 2025 security update for the Galaxy Z Fold 3 and Flip 3 is now being made available in more regions, including Europe and the US. In Europe, the Galaxy Z Fold 3 and Flip 3 have been assigned version numbers F926BXXSAIYB1 and F711BXXSAIYB1, respectively.
In the US, the latest software update for the Galaxy Z Fold 3 and Z Flip 3, which includes the February patch, is available for both carrier-locked (T-Mobile) devices with version numbers F926USQS9JYB1 and F711USQS9JYB1, as well as unlocked units with version numbers F926U1UES9JYB1 and F711U1UESAJYB1, respectively.
Although the update does not introduce any significant new features or changes, its primary focus is on enhancing the device’s overall security and core functionality. It incorporates numerous fixes for security vulnerabilities addressed in the previous version, providing users with a safer and more secure experience while protecting the device from potential threats.
In addition to this, the update enhances the stability of the overall system behavior and brings certain performance optimizations, allowing users to enjoy a smooth, optimized, and efficient user experience and functionality.
